Police called to dispute at Timmies

OHSWEKEN — Six Nations Police were dispatched to a disturbance involving two vehicles at the Tim Horton’s drive-thru Tuesday morning — reporting that one of the vehicles was trying to ram the other.

Additional information was provided that a male from one of the vehicles had a handgun.

Responding police units surrounded the Tim Horton’s and contained the suspect vehicle and detained the male driver who was reported to have a firearm.  Upon investigation, no firearm was involved.  The male was, in fact, taking a picture with his phone of the vehicle involved.

No charges were laid.  Both vehicles and drivers left the area without incident.
